Publisher Description: Warplanes have only been around for about 100 years. How have they changed from biplanes and triplanes to jets that fly faster than the speed of sound? Learn about fighter planes that are invisible to radar and bombers that can destroy whole cities. |
Contributor Bio(s): Cooke, Tim: - Tim Cooke is a graduate of Oxford University. He has worked in children's publishing for over 20 years as an author and editor. Among his publications as writer or editor are numerous sets about military history, particularly the American Revolution, the Civil War, World Wars I and II, and the Vietnam War. He has also written widely about general history, including How to Change the World With a Ball of String (Scholastic, 2011). |
